Definition of COMPLETE

noun
  1. A completed survey.

verb
  1. To finish; to make done; to reach the end.

    "He completed the assignment on time."

    Synonyms: accomplish finish
  2. To make whole or entire.

    "The last chapter completes the book nicely."

  3. To call from the small blind in an unraised pot.

adjective
  1. With all parts included; with nothing missing; full.

    "After she found the rook, the chess set was complete."

    Synonyms: entire total
  2. Finished; ended; concluded; completed.

    "When your homework is complete, you can go and play with Martin."

    Synonyms: concluded done
  3. Generic intensifier.

    "He is a complete bastard!"

    Synonyms: downright utter
